Definition And Overview

The most publicized use of nanotechnology in drug delivery under development is the use of nanoparticles to deliver drugs to cancer cells. Particles are engineered so that they are attracted to diseased cells, which allows direct treatment of those cells. This technique reduces damage to healthy cells in the body.

It is a growing area and is witnessing rising acceptance in applications in health care. It is broadly used in applications like anti-infective, neurology, cardiovascular disorders, among others. 

One active and important application area is to commute drugs to the location of therapeutic interference within the body. The market is observing swift growth owing to rise in R&D activities to develop novel nano-medicine in nanotechnology. 

Strict regulations scenario and huge improvement cost of medicines are expected to hamper Nanotechnology Drug Delivery growth.
